Output eb25d792ca40410d8d92d6ef79399886b7e19e0abe67aec0d7e86b7861b8691d:55

value
527832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ff654398c8742b5a2a1b96d44e5dbb047ec4cd2 OP_EQUAL
address
364cmoHzWPJx31359fBW8owTUvi8d23BxX
transaction
eb25d792ca40410d8d92d6ef79399886b7e19e0abe67aec0d7e86b7861b8691d